NXP MIMXRT1064CVJ5B: 高性能、低功耗的i.MX RT1064系列微控制器

NXP MIMXRT1064CVJ5B 是一款高性能、低功耗的微控制器 (MCU),隶属于 i.MX RT1064 系列。它采用 Arm Cortex-M7 内核,具有丰富的功能和外设,适合各种应用,从工业自动化到消费电子产品。

# 一、产品规格

* 内核: Arm Cortex-M7,主频高达 600MHz

* 内存: 1MB SRAM,2MB Flash

* 外设:

* 12 个 12 位 ADC

* 2 个 DAC

* 1 个 CAN 总线

* 3 个 SPI 接口

* 2 个 I2C 接口

* 1 个 SDIO 接口

* 1 个 USB 2.0 PHY

* 1 个以太网 MAC

* 1 个 FlexCAN 接口

* 1 个 SDHC 接口

* 1 个 LCD 接口

* 1 个 CSI 接口

* 1 个 DPI 接口

* 1 个 SAI 接口

* 1 个 RTC

* 封装: LFBGA-196

* 工作温度: -40°C ~ +105°C

* 电源电压: 1.8V

# 二、核心优势

* 高性能: 基于 Arm Cortex-M7 内核,最高主频可达 600MHz,可满足高性能运算需求。

* 低功耗: 采用先进的低功耗技术,在提供高性能的同时,还能降低功耗,延长电池寿命。

* 丰富的功能和外设: 提供了各种常用的外设,例如 ADC、DAC、CAN 总线、SPI 接口、I2C 接口、SDIO 接口、USB 2.0 PHY、以太网 MAC 等,方便用户进行开发。

* 安全可靠: 支持多种安全功能,例如 TrustZone 技术、安全启动等,确保应用安全可靠。

* 易于开发: 提供了丰富的开发工具和文档,方便用户快速进行开发。

# 三、应用领域

MIMXRT1064CVJ5B 凭借其高性能、低功耗、丰富的功能和外设,在各个领域都有广泛应用,包括:

* 工业自动化: 用于控制和监测工业设备,例如机器人、自动化生产线等。

* 消费电子: 用于开发智能家居设备、可穿戴设备、无线充电器等。

* 医疗设备: 用于开发医疗仪器、诊断设备等。

* 汽车电子: 用于开发汽车控制系统、车载娱乐系统等。

* 物联网: 用于开发各种智能物联网设备,例如传感器节点、网关等。

# 四、功能特性

* Arm Cortex-M7 处理器: 核心性能高达 600MHz,可满足复杂算法的执行需求。

* 内存: 1MB SRAM 提供充足的存储空间,可用于存放数据和代码。2MB Flash 可用于存储程序代码、数据和配置信息。

* ADC: 12 个 12 位 ADC 可用于采集各种传感器数据。

* DAC: 2 个 DAC 可用于驱动外部设备,例如扬声器、LED 等。

* CAN 总线: 支持 CAN 总线通信,可用于工业自动化和汽车电子领域。

* SPI 接口: 3 个 SPI 接口可用于与各种外设通信,例如传感器、显示器等。

* I2C 接口: 2 个 I2C 接口可用于与各种外设通信,例如传感器、存储器等。

* SDIO 接口: 支持 SDIO 接口,可用于连接 SD 卡等存储设备。

* USB 2.0 PHY: 支持 USB 2.0 通信,可用于连接各种 USB 设备。

* 以太网 MAC: 支持以太网通信,可用于联网应用。

* FlexCAN 接口: 支持 FlexCAN 总线通信,可用于工业自动化和汽车电子领域。

* SDHC 接口: 支持 SDHC 接口,可用于连接 SDHC 卡等存储设备。

* LCD 接口: 支持 LCD 接口,可用于驱动 LCD 显示器。

* CSI 接口: 支持 CSI 接口,可用于连接摄像头。

* DPI 接口: 支持 DPI 接口,可用于连接显示器。

* SAI 接口: 支持 SAI 接口,可用于音频处理。

* RTC: 支持 RTC,可用于计时和日期管理。

# 五、开发资源

NXP 为 MIMXRT1064CVJ5B 提供了丰富的开发资源,包括:

* 开发板: 提供了各种开发板,方便用户进行硬件设计和开发。

* 软件开发工具: 提供了集成开发环境 (IDE)、调试器、仿真器等软件工具,方便用户进行软件开发。

* 文档: 提供了丰富的文档,包括用户手册、数据手册、应用笔记等,方便用户理解和使用芯片。

* 社区: 提供了活跃的社区,方便用户与其他开发者交流,获取技术支持。

# 六、总结

NXP MIMXRT1064CVJ5B 是一款功能强大、性能优越的微控制器,适合各种应用。其高性能、低功耗、丰富的功能和外设,以及丰富的开发资源,使其成为各种嵌入式系统开发的理想选择。